(1) The condition of living or the state of being alive.
(2) The property of being able to survive and grow.
(3) Quality of being active or spirited or alive and vigorous.
(4) The activity of giving vitality and vigour to something.
(5) The making of animated cartoons.
(6) General activity and motion.
(7) Liveliness; activity.
